Festivals AJ Tracey, Gorillaz, girl in red among new Øya additions

First Aid Kit, Nubya Garcia and Sons of Kemet have also been confirmed.
A new batch of names has been added to next year’s Øya Festival in Norway.
AJ Tracey, Gorillaz, girl in red, First Aid Kit and Mercury-shortlisted Nubya Garcia are among the additions, who will join acts including Nick Cave & The Bad Seeds, Michael Kiwanuka, Pa Salieu, Bikini Kill and Beabadoobee at Oslo’s Tøyenparken between 9th and 13th August.
Also confirmed today are Margo Price, Sons of Kemet, Kamaal Williams, Arif, Signe Marie Rusad, Myra, Karama, and Skarbø Skulekorps.
